HB2964

Cancer screening; coverage; gene mutation

Arizona HB2964 mandates coverage for genetic testing and counseling for inherited cancer risks by insurers and health care providers.

Arizona HB2964 requires insurers and health care providers to cover genetic testing and counseling for individuals with inherited genetic mutations linked to increased cancer risks. This includes BRCA genes and Lynch Syndrome genes. Coverage includes genetic tests, genetic counseling, and germline mutation testing, without cost-sharing requirements. Primary care providers must screen adult patients for these risks and refer them for genetic counseling and testing if necessary. The act applies to policies and contracts issued or renewed after January 1, 2027.
